Redmi Turbo 4 Pro Debuts With Snapdragon 8s Gen 4, 7,550mAh Battery: Full Specs and Pricing Revealed

Redmi has unveiled the new Turbo 4 Pro in China, packing impressive hardware and features designed for high performance. The smartphone is powered by Qualcomm’s Snapdragon 8s Gen 4 chipset, an octa-core processor that promises smooth multitasking and gaming experiences. With up to 16GB of LPDDR5X RAM, the device ensures rapid app switching and efficient memory management. In terms of storage, users can choose from configurations ranging from 256GB to a whopping 1TB of UFS 4.1 storage. This ample storage, coupled with powerful RAM, makes the Redmi Turbo 4 Pro a compelling option for users seeking performance and space for their data.

One of the standout features of the Turbo 4 Pro is its display. The phone boasts a large 6.83-inch OLED screen with a 1.5K resolution (1280×2800 pixels), delivering sharp, vibrant visuals. The display supports a 120Hz refresh rate for fluid scrolling and gaming, along with a peak brightness of 3,200 nits for excellent visibility under direct sunlight. The 3,840Hz PWM dimming ensures eye comfort, while Dolby Vision support elevates the viewing experience with enhanced contrast and color accuracy. This display makes the phone a great choice for media consumption, gaming, and productivity.

The camera setup on the Redmi Turbo 4 Pro is another highlight. It features a 50-megapixel Sony LYT-600 primary sensor with optical image stabilization (OIS), electronic image stabilization (EIS), and a wide f/1.5 aperture. This ensures that photos are sharp and clear, even in low-light environments. An 8-megapixel ultra-wide camera further expands your photographic possibilities, and the 20-megapixel front-facing camera ensures high-quality selfies and video calls. The phone’s photography capabilities, paired with its powerful internals, make it a strong contender in the premium smartphone segment.

The battery is also impressive, with the Redmi Turbo 4 Pro coming equipped with a massive 7,550mAh battery. This large capacity ensures long hours of usage, whether you’re gaming, streaming, or working. Additionally, the phone supports 90W fast charging, allowing users to quickly charge their device and get back to using it. Reverse charging at 22.5W is another useful feature, letting you charge other devices with your phone. For those concerned about durability, the Redmi Turbo 4 Pro meets IP66, IP68, and IP69 ratings for water and dust resistance, making it suitable for tough conditions. Redmi Watch Move With 1.85-Inch AMOLED Display and 14-Day Battery Life Unveiled in India: Price and Features Revealed

Redmi has officially launched the Watch Move in India, bringing a new, budget-friendly option for smartwatch enthusiasts. The device features a sleek, rectangular 1.85-inch AMOLED display with a 2.5D curved design and a rotating crown for easy navigation. The watch boasts an impressive set of health and wellness tracking features, with a claimed accuracy rate of 98.5%. It operates on Xiaomi’s HyperOS and supports the Hindi language, ensuring accessibility for a broad audience. With up to 14 days of battery life, the Redmi Watch Move is positioned as a practical yet stylish choice for users seeking a long-lasting, feature-packed smartwatch.

The pricing for the Redmi Watch Move in India is set at Rs. 1,999, making it an affordable option for those wanting to experience advanced smartwatch features without breaking the bank. The smartwatch will be available for purchase starting May 1 via Flipkart, the official Xiaomi India website, and select Xiaomi retail stores. Pre-bookings will open on April 24, allowing early adopters to secure their device in advance. It will be available in four attractive color options: Blue Blaze, Black Drift, Gold Rush, and Silver Sprint, giving users a variety of choices to match their style.

In terms of features, the Redmi Watch Move is equipped with a range of fitness and health-tracking tools. The 1.85-inch AMOLED display offers a vibrant viewing experience, with a resolution of 390 x 450 pixels, 600 nits brightness, and a 60Hz refresh rate. Users can track over 140 different sports modes, along with vital health metrics such as heart rate, blood oxygen levels (SpO₂), stress levels, sleep cycles, and even menstrual cycles. The watch also supports Bluetooth calling, making it easy to take calls directly from the device, and it syncs with real-time updates such as weather, tasks, and calendar events through the HyperOS interface.

The Redmi Watch Move also offers a high level of customization and usability. Its rotating crown allows users to effortlessly scroll through apps and alerts, providing a smooth and intuitive interface. The watch is built with durability in mind, featuring an anti-allergy TPU strap and an IP68 rating for dust and water resistance, making it suitable for a variety of environments. Compatibility with both Android and iOS devices, as well as the Mi Fitness App, ensures that users can easily sync their data and track their progress, while the ability to store up to 10 contacts on the watch adds an extra layer of convenience.

Redmi Turbo 4 Pro to Launch: Design and Color Variants Unveiled

The highly anticipated Redmi Turbo 4 Pro is set to be unveiled later this week, with the company revealing key details about its design and features ahead of the launch. Teasers have confirmed that the smartphone will sport a sharp 2.5K resolution display, promising an immersive viewing experience. The device will be powered by the Snapdragon 8s Gen 4 chipset, ensuring top-tier performance. Its design appears to closely resemble the standard Redmi Turbo 4, which was introduced in China earlier this year. Unlike the standard version, which comes with a MediaTek Dimensity 8400-Ultra SoC and a 1.5K OLED display, the Pro variant takes things up a notch with its advanced specifications.

Set to launch in China on April 24 at 7 PM local time (4:30 PM IST), the Redmi Turbo 4 Pro has been teased in various posts, offering a glimpse into its sleek design. The handset is expected to feature a dual rear camera setup, positioned vertically in the top-left corner of the back panel within a pill-shaped module. An elongated LED flash unit is placed beside the camera array, enhancing the phone’s photographic capabilities. The Redmi Turbo 4 Pro will also sport a flat display with slim, uniform bezels and a centered hole-punch cutout for the front camera, providing a modern and clean look.

In terms of build, the phone will have a metal middle frame with rounded corners, giving it a premium feel. The back cover is made of “soft mist glass,” offering a smooth texture and aesthetic appeal. As for color options, the Redmi Turbo 4 Pro will be available in three distinct shades: black, green, and white, giving users a variety of choices to suit their personal style. This range of colors adds a touch of customization and flair to the device’s overall design.

Under the hood, the Redmi Turbo 4 Pro is expected to be a powerhouse. Equipped with the Snapdragon 8s Gen 4 SoC, it will offer excellent performance for gaming, multitasking, and everyday use. The phone is also expected to feature up to 24GB of LPDDR5x RAM and UFS 4.0 storage, which should ensure fast data access and smooth app performance.
